ARA Hardware, a division of the ARA Group, is a well-established and leading NZ supplier of door hardware to the construction industry. They are passionate about what they do and strive to be the industry leader in their field. Their collaborative approach with architects, estimators, project managers, and builders reflects their commitment to delivering an outstanding service experience on every project.
About the role:
We are looking for a seasoned Project Coordinator who thrives on delivering critical commercial projects. Reporting to the Operations Manager, you will oversee all aspects of the project cycle, from setting deadlines to monitoring progress to reporting to management on the status of all WIP and completed works. You will be key to ensuring the successful delivery of commercial projects and solidifying ARA Hardware's reputation as the industry's leading hardware supplier and installer.
